The mediating effect of psychological capital and voice behavior efficacy on inclusive leadership and voice behavior of nurses
Objective To explore the relationship between inclusive leadership,psychological capital,voice behav-ior efficacy and voice behavior of nurses.Methods A total of 293 nurses from three Grade A tertiary hospitals in Sichuan and Guizhou were selected by convenience sampling method from January 2022 to March 2022.General data questionnaire,Inclusive Leadership Scale,Psychological Capital Questionnaire,Voice Behavior Efficacy Scale and Voice Behavior Scale were used to investigate them.Results A total of 286 nurses were finally included.The scores for inclusive leadership were(3.74±0.67),psychological capital(4.46±0.61),voice behavior efficacy(3.57± 0.69),and voice behavior(5.40±1.04).Inclusive leadership,psychological capital,voice behavior efficacy,and voice behavior were positively correlated(r=0.460-0.614,P<0.001).The mediation model revealed that the direct effect of inclusive leadership on voice behavior was significant(β=0.166,P<0.001).Besides,inclusive leadership could also affect voice behavior through three pathways:the mediating effect of psychological capital(β=0.221,P<0.001),the mediating effect of voice behavior efficacy(β=0.189,P<0.001),and the chain mediating effect of psychological capi-tal and voice behavior efficacy(β=0.109,P<0.001),with the mediating effects accounting for 75.77%of the total ef-fects.Conclusion Psychological resources and voice efficacy play mediating effects between inclusive leadership and nurses'voice behavior.It is suggested that hospital managers should pay attention to shaping the inclusive leadership style,enhance nurses'voice efficacy by increasing nurses'positive psychological resources,and finally pro-mote nurses'voice behavior.
